SPACE
Please find attached four fact sheets created by SPACE (Supporting Parents and Children Emotionally)
The aim of these factsheets is to provide support and strategies, whatever your situation, and are based on what SPACE know about people’s responses to events that provoke uncertainty and anxiety. The fact sheets will give you some techniques to look after your children by looking after yourself, some activity ideas and strategies to consider to help you deal with all types of behaviours in your children.
